
The AFC matchups will resume when the Miami Dolphins take on the Baltimore Ravens in Thursday Night Football. After ending a four-game losing streak with a 30-16 win over the Bears, Baltimore (2-5) will look to continue their momentum, while Miami (2-6) aims to build on their previous victory against Atlanta (34-10).
Kickoff is scheduled for 8:15 PM ET at Hard Rock Stadium, and the Ravens hold a favorable 9-3 record in their last 12 games against the Dolphins. Injury reports indicate starring players Lamar Jackson and Tua Tagovailoa are expected to play despite recent concerns.
